I typically work with my laptop docked. It would be really neat to enable clam shell mode when the laptop is closed so that I can access my primary workspace without having to manually disable or reenable monitors in the monitors.conf. Tools like hyprdock and kanshi make this possible but it's very annoying. In the spirit of Omarchy It would be awesome to have this baked in. I believe it could be done with a bash script but my scripting skills need work.
